-
- VSCode配置管理技巧_团队统一开发环境
- 通过settings.json统一编辑器行为,如缩进、自动保存和格式化;2.使用extensions.json推荐必备插件,确保工具一致;3.集成Prettier与ESLint实现代码风格自动化;4.借助.gitignore排除私有配置,仅共享公共设置。
- VSCode . 开发工具 715 2025-11-25 14:33:06
-
- VSCode Rust配置指南_系统级编程环境搭建
- 首先安装Rust工具链并配置rustup,然后在VSCode中安装RustAnalyzer、CodeLLDB等插件,接着用cargonew创建项目并配置settings.json启用保存时检查,最后设置launch.json实现调试,完成高效稳定的Rust开发环境搭建。
- VSCode . 开发工具 650 2025-11-25 14:32:02
-
- VSCode容器开发环境_DevContainer标准化配置指南
- DevContainer是VSCode结合Docker实现的标准化开发环境方案,通过.devcontainer/目录下的devcontainer.json和Dockerfile定义依赖、工具链与扩展,实现开箱即用、跨项目复用的统一环境。
- VSCode . 开发工具 783 2025-11-25 14:30:58
-
- VS Code快捷键绑定高级技巧:when子句的使用
- 通过when子句可实现VSCode快捷键的情境化控制,1.利用editorTextFocus、editorLangId等条件限定触发环境,2.结合逻辑运算符组合条件,3.在keybindings.json中配置差异化行为,4.使用Developer:InspectContextKeys调试上下文状态,使快捷键按场景智能生效。
- VSCode . 开发工具 247 2025-11-25 14:24:06
-
- 如何在 composer 中使用 path 类型的仓库来开发和测试本地包?
- 配置path仓库可实现本地PHP包开发实时测试,通过在主项目composer.json中添加type为path的仓库并指定本地路径,Composer会自动软链接或复制包到vendor目录,要求本地包具备正确命名和autoload配置的composer.json,修改代码后主项目即时生效,适合快速迭代,但仅限开发环境使用,完成开发后应切换至git等远程仓库源。
- composer . 开发工具 580 2025-11-25 14:23:02
-
- 如何在一个项目中同时使用多个版本的同一个composer包?
- 无法直接通过Composer同时使用同一包的多个版本,因Composer会统一版本并仅安装一个。若需在项目中实现多版本共存,可采用以下方案:1.使用命名空间隔离,通过php-scoper或手动修改命名空间将不同版本重命名为独立空间,如Vendor\Package与Vendor\PackageV1,并通过PSR-4加载;2.利用PHP-Scoper构建隔离作用域,适用于PHAR或插件环境,避免依赖冲突;3.拆分为多个独立服务或脚本,每个服务拥有独立的composer.json和vendor目录,通
- composer . 开发工具 876 2025-11-25 14:15:08
-
- 如何使用 composer config --global 持久化配置?
- 使用composerconfig--global可将配置写入用户主目录的~/.composer/config.json,影响系统所有项目;支持设置镜像仓库、禁用TLS、配置GitHubToken和缓存目录,通过--list查看、--unset删除配置,实现全局持久化管理。
- composer . 开发工具 502 2025-11-25 14:11:02
-
- VSCode文件系统提供者_虚拟文件系统集成方案
- 答案:VSCode通过FileSystemProviderAPI实现虚拟文件系统,允许将远程或内存资源以文件形式集成。注册自定义协议(如myvfs:),实现readDirectory、stat、readFile、writeFile等方法,并调用workspace.registerFileSystemProvider挂载。用户可在资源管理器中浏览虚拟目录、读写内容并监听变更,支持只读或可写模式。典型应用包括远程配置管理、数据库可视化、嵌入式开发和低代码平台。注意事项:虚拟文件默认不参与搜索,需Te
- VSCode . 开发工具 521 2025-11-25 14:09:08
-
- VSCode项目管理艺术:从启动配置到构建部署
- VSCode通过配置launch.json实现精准调试,tasks.json统一构建流程,结合扩展或脚本集成部署,推荐安装必要插件并统一设置,提升开发效率与团队协作一致性。
- VSCode . 开发工具 118 2025-11-25 14:04:02
-
- 移动开发工作流:VSCode与React Native开发环境
- 首先安装Node.js和ExpoCLI,创建项目后配置VSCode及ESLint、Prettier等插件实现自动格式化;通过ReactNativeTools调试,启用热重载与真机联调;利用代码片段、智能提示和终端分屏提升编码效率;最终使用Expo或原生工具构建发布应用,确保关闭调试模式。
- VSCode . 开发工具 510 2025-11-25 13:57:19
-
- composer init 命令使用教程:如何从零创建 composer.json?
- 运行composerinit可交互式创建composer.json,依次填写包名、描述、作者、稳定性、许可证等信息,并添加依赖如monolog/monolog^2.0,最后确认生成文件并执行composerinstall安装依赖。
- composer . 开发工具 608 2025-11-25 13:57:06
-
- 如何利用 composer.json 的 "conflict" 字段防止包版本冲突?
- "conflict"字段用于声明当前包不兼容的其他包版本,防止依赖冲突。例如在composer.json中指定{"conflict":{"framework/core":"3.0.0"}},可阻止该版本安装,避免API不兼容问题。结合"replace"可实现功能替代并防止重复加载,如替换psr/cache时排除原包。需谨慎使用,仅在存在严重Bug或功能冲突时精确设置,避免过度限制依赖,提升项目稳定性。
- composer . 开发工具 359 2025-11-25 13:53:02
-
- sublime怎么快速包裹选中的代码块_sublime使用快捷键添加包裹标签或语句方法
- 使用Emmet可高效包裹代码:先选中内容,按Ctrl+Alt+W或通过命令面板选择“WrapwithAbbreviation”,输入标签名如div.container,回车后即完成包裹,适用于HTML等格式,提升编码效率。
- sublime . 开发工具 155 2025-11-25 13:49:47
-
- sublime怎么安装vue语法高亮插件_sublime配置vue开发环境
- 要配置SublimeText的Vue开发环境,需先安装PackageControl,再通过它安装VueSyntaxHighlight插件实现语法高亮,接着设置.vue文件默认打开方式为VueComponent,可选装Emmet、Babel等辅助插件,最后创建测试文件验证HTML、JS、CSS高亮效果。
- sublime . 开发工具 364 2025-11-25 13:43:49
-
- sublime怎么处理GBK编码的文件_sublime正确读写非UTF8文件
- 安装ConvertToUTF8插件后,SublimeText可自动识别并正确显示GBK编码文件,支持编辑保存时自动转码,避免乱码;若未自动识别,可手动通过命令面板选择“ReopenwithEncoding”或“SavewithEncoding”切换为GBK编码,确保中文正常显示。
- sublime . 开发工具 346 2025-11-25 13:34:02
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

